  • Patent number: 9909485
    Abstract: A cooling fan module includes a frame, and a fan impeller having a plurality of fan impeller blades is located in an opening of the frame. The fan impeller blades are connected to a base portion of an outer fan ring. A lip portion of the outer fan ring extends from the base portion radially outward, and a leading end of the lip portion is turned in direction to the downstream side of the frame. A recirculating flow guiding device includes a plurality of guide vanes located on an upstream side of the frame and around the opening of the frame. An air gap is provided between the outer fan ring and the frame. A recirculating flow travels from downstream side of the cooling fan module through the air gap, and is turned by the leading end of the lip portion into the recirculating flow guiding device.

  • Patent number: 9873411
    Abstract: An actuator (1), especially for a motor vehicle parking brake has a telescopic device (2) that actuates a brake cable (6), and a drive unit which is equipped with an electromechanical drive for actuating the telescopic device (2). The actuator (1) further has a displacement sensor unit for detecting the actuating travel of the telescopic device (2) as well as a force sensor unit for detecting the force applied to the brake cable (6) by the drive unit. The displacement sensor unit and the force sensor unit are disposed next to each other in or on the housing (3) of the telescopic device (2) while being separated from the brake cable (6). The assembly has a particularly simple and compact design while reducing the constructive and mounting effort required during the production of the actuator.

  • Patent number: 9843240
    Abstract: An electric motor has efficient self-cooling. The electric motor contains a rotor that is rotatably mounted with respect to a stator. On a first sub-segment of an end face of the rotor, a first air-guiding contour is formed that, during rotation of the rotor in a reference rotation direction, generates an outwardly directed air flow. On a second sub-segment of the same end face, a second air-guide contour is formed that, during rotation of the rotor in a reference rotation direction, generates an inwardly directed air flow.

  • Patent number: 9774280
    Abstract: The present invention discloses a monitoring device for an electric machine, comprising a first detection apparatus which is configured to detect electrical power supplied to the electric machine, comprising a second detection apparatus which is configured to detect theoretical mechanical power output by the electric machine on the basis of a commutation of the electric machine, and comprising a calculation apparatus which, on the basis of the detected electrical power and of the detected theoretical mechanical power, is configured to calculate an efficiency of the electric machine and to emit an error signal if the calculated efficiency is greater than 1. The present invention further discloses a control device for an electric machine and a method for monitoring an electric machine.
